Travis Parman

VP, Communications at Nissan

Travis Parman is vice president of communications for Nissan North America, Inc., and of international communications and global engagement for Nissan Motor Co., Ltd. He was appointed to this position in June 2019. In this role, Parman is responsible for leading Nissan's communications and corporate social responsibility functions in the United States, Canada and Mexico as well as global regional alignment and strategy and Nissan Alliance-wide communications. He provides counsel and support to Nissan North America President and Chairman José Valls and the company's senior leadership.

Previously, Parman was based in Yokohama, Japan, managing the global communications teams for Nissan Motor Co. Prior to that he served as vice president of international communications and global performance at Groupe Renault in Paris.

Parman is a PR Week "40 Under 40" honoree and has taught international public relations at Western Kentucky University. He earned his master's degree at the Syracuse University Newhouse School of Public Communications and his bachelor's degree at the University of Tennessee. He is a member of the Arthur W. Page Society.
